Best time to visit Lebanon
The best time to visit Lebanon is during the spring months, from April to June, when the weather is mild, and the landscapes burst into a riot of colors. The pleasant temperatures make it ideal for exploring historic sites like Baalbek and enjoying the picturesque beauty of the Lebanese co